Slate tile floor installation involves carefully selecting and placing durable, attractive slate tiles to create a long-lasting flooring surface. This service typically includes preparing the existing subfloor, measuring and planning the layout, and securely installing each tile with appropriate adhesive and grout. Proper installation ensures the floor is level, stable, and resistant to common issues like cracking or shifting over time. Service providers experienced in slate tile installation can help homeowners achieve a sophisticated look that enhances the overall appearance of a space.
This type of flooring installation can address several common problems faced by homeowners. For example, slate tiles are naturally resistant to moisture and stains, making them an ideal choice for kitchens, bathrooms, and entryways prone to spills or humidity. Additionally, slate's durability helps prevent cracking and chipping that can occur with other flooring materials. The overview below groups typical Slate Tile Floor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- For minor fixes like replacing broken tiles or sealing grout, local pros typically charge between $250 and $600. These projects are common and usually fall within this lower to mid-range cost band.
Standard Installation - Installing new slate tiles across a standard room often costs between $1,500 and $4,000. Many routine projects land in this middle range, though larger spaces may cost more.
Full Room Renovation - Complete overhauls of multiple rooms or large areas can range from $4,000 to $10,000 or more, depending on size and complexity. Fewer projects reach the highest tiers, which are reserved for extensive renovations.
Full Replacement - Replacing an existing slate floor entirely usually falls between $3,000 and $8,000. Larger, more detailed jobs can exceed this range, but most projects stay within this typical band.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are the benefits of choosing slate tile for a floor? Slate tile offers a natural, durable surface that can enhance the aesthetic appeal of any space, providing long-lasting beauty and functionality.
How do local contractors prepare for slate tile floor installation? They typically assess the subfloor, ensure proper measurements, and select suitable slate tiles to ensure a secure and even installation.
What factors should be considered when selecting slate tiles for flooring? Consider the tile's thickness, finish, color variation, and slip resistance to match the needs of the space and desired look.
Can slate tile floors be installed over existing surfaces? Yes, many local service providers can install slate tiles over existing floors if the surface is stable and suitable for tile adhesion.
What maintenance is required to keep slate tile floors looking their best? Regular cleaning with gentle, pH-neutral cleaners and occasional sealing can help preserve the appearance and durability of slate tile floors.
